Being abducted by aliens to be mated to their king is not how Aria imagined her dream vacation would begin.
Aria’s career fills the void that foster care left behind, but recently, steamy, erotic dreams make her think she’s working too hard.
A free trip to a luxury resort is just the ticket. Until she’s ushered to a “VIP party” and abducted by an alien who insists she’s his king’s soul-mate. Love at first sight, let alone sight unseen, is a myth. Her increasing attraction to the ship’s captain, however, is far too real.
Captain Tai Gaman’s mission was simple. Kidnap Aria and deliver her to his king. What’s complicated is the blinding desire he feels for the Earth woman that is almost impossible to resist.
As the sexual hunger between them reaches unbearable height, Tai must make the most difficult decision of his life. Claim her as his own, or fulfill his duty to the king.
Forbidden Mate is the first book in Opal Carew’s sexy sci-fi romance series, Abducted. If you love stories with a captivity theme that lead to passion and everlasting love (and a lot of exciting, explicit sexual encounters), then you’ll love every story in the Abducted series.

Smut. Almost entirely smut. Alien abduction and menage smut.
There is a small bit of a story arc, and a little hint of characters, but the focus is clearly the sizzle with (gentle and caring but horny) alien abductors.
Not bad if one is looking for a nicely explicit and erotic alien abduction and menage fantasy, complete with a minor trick of alien anatomy (which seemed out of place to me but that many readers might appreciate).
While I appreciate some explicit smut, there was just enough interesting hints of story and setting for me to wish this work had more of the development and intrigue that was only very lightly explored by the author.
Probably a 3.5 to 4 star read for those looking for alien menage erotica (mfm) in an interesting setting. 1.5 stars for readers who prefer their erotic encounters be wrapped deeply in an intriguing, enveloping story and fully developed characters.
